USPTO Abstract
The present invention provides anti-VEGF human monoclonal antibodies capable of binding to human VEGF to neutralize its activity, cell strains producing said human monoclonal antibody, and vascularization inhibitors containing said human monoclonal antibodies. Hybridoma strains VA01 and BL2 FERM BP-5607 and FERM BP-5424 producing the anti-VEGF human monoclonal antibody are provided by transformation with Epstein-Barr Virus (EBV) of human lymphocyte producing anti-human VEGF antibody and then fusing the transformant cells with human myeloma cells. The monoclonal antibodies can serve as vascularization inhibitors, useful for humans because it is derived from human and capable of binding specifically to VEGF participating in vascularization, to inhibit the migration or proliferation of vascular endothelial cells.
